MDS Orthodontics and Dentofacial Orthopedics is a specialized postgraduate dental program focusing on the diagnosis, prevention, interception, and correction of malocclusion (bad bite) and other dentofacial deformities. This branch of dentistry combines orthodontic treatment, which involves the use of braces and aligners to straighten teeth, with dentofacial orthopedics, which addresses skeletal and facial imbalances.

MDS in Orthodontics and Dentofacial Orthopedics is a specialized postgraduate dental program focusing on correcting teeth and jaw irregularities. It combines theoretical knowledge with extensive clinical practice.3-Year Postgraduate Course
This MDS program is typically a 3-year course, providing comprehensive training in orthodontic treatments, diagnosis, and research methodologies.Comprehensive Clinical Assessments
The program includes rigorous clinical assessments, practical exams, and thesis submissions to evaluate the student's proficiency in orthodontic procedures and patient management.BDS Degree Required
Candidates must possess a BDS (Bachelor of Dental Surgery) degree from a recognized dental college, along with completion of a mandatory rotatory internship. Some colleges may also require a good score in NEET-MDS.NEET-MDS Entrance Exam
Admission is primarily based on the NEET-MDS (National Eligibility cum Entrance Test for Master of Dental Surgery) score, followed by counseling conducted by DGHS (Directorate General of Health Services) or respective state authorities.Varies by Institution
The course fee varies significantly depending on the institution, ranging from INR 2 Lakhs to INR 15 Lakhs per year. Government colleges typically have lower fees compared to private dental colleges.Hospitals & Dental Clinics
